all - Load all packages under a namespace
# use everything in the IO:: namespace use all of => 'IO::*'; use all 'IO::*'; # use everything in the IO:: and Sys:: namespaces use all 'IO::*', 'Sys::*'; use all of => qw{IO::* Sys::*};
With the all pragma you can load multiple modules that share the same root namespace. This vastly reduces the amount of times you need to spend use'ing modules.
This will remove the ability to use exported / optionally exported functions.
